Course overview

Learn how to navigate power dynamics at work.

Power is rarely discussed explicitly at work, but it’s present everywhere – from casual Slack chats to major promotion decisions. This deeply-researched course will help you understand how power works at work, so you can navigate crucial interactions with more intention, gain buy-in, be more visible and influential, and ultimately accelerate your career.


After years of navigating work politics as operators and providing executive coaching to high-achieving women, we built this course because we noticed women engaging with power in ways that are different from men -- or avoiding the topic all together. By addressing how power works head-on, we believe women will be better equipped to find satisfaction and success at work, even in male-dominated or hyper-political environments.


Our course is rooted in research, brought to life by group discussion and personal anecdotes, and is designed for female professionals.

Meet your instructors

Caroline Fay

Caroline Fay

Founder, The Extra Group

Caroline Fay, Founder and Principal of the Extra Group, is an executive coach and exited tech founder. She has built and sold a venture-backed inclusive hiring startup, designed go-to-market strategies and product launches at HR tech unicorn Lattice, and studied career development for the working adult at the Harvard Graduate School of Education.

Kristine Kern

Kristine Kern

Co-Founder, Realize

Kristine Kern, cofounder of Realize, is an executive coach and expert on teams. She started her career in publishing and spent more than 10 years as a consultant with Patrick Lencioni's Table Group working with leaders to build high-performing teams. She works out of offices in New York City and Oakland.
